The overexcitation limit of synchronous generator plays an important role in the voltage stability of power systems. Achieving maximum use of the overexcitation capability requires adequate coordination between generator control and protection. This paper presents a general approach to locate any type of fault on either a single-circuit or a double-circuit transmission line when only voltage sag data are available. The voltage measurements employed can be from one bus, two buses, or more buses, which are not restricted to those of the faulted section. The impact of distributed generation (DG) in a distribution network depends on the design of the protection system and the coordination between the different protective devices. This paper presents the main features of a library of protective devices implemented in an EMTP-type tool for power quality studies in distribution networks with distributed generation.
